      Meaning of the first name
      Adelgiso

      Origin 
      Germanic Roots, Noble Lineage

      Meaning 
      Noble And Powerful Ruler

      Variations 
      Adalgiso, Adelgise, Edelgiso

      *Some content has been generated by an artificial intelligence language model, in combination with data sourced from Ancestry records and provided by BabyNames.com.
      The name Adelgiso is derived from Germanic roots, combining elements that signify nobility and power. Specifically, adel refers to nobility, while gis is linked to the concept of a ruler or power. This etymology underscores the name's association with strong leadership and noble lineage, suggesting an individual of great stature and influence. As such, Adelgiso embodies characteristics of authority, strength, and distinction.
